Output 5abd2909892367bb64a3bac6454e403268155f01dd59f0ae06bb579254479237:8

value
175238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aef3b5b2a59fa8205a95cec9b9dab0adbed6835 OP_EQUAL
address
3EMdm8vPgodGxNJHozp4JT9r62UKcHkhet
transaction
5abd2909892367bb64a3bac6454e403268155f01dd59f0ae06bb579254479237
confirmations
192980
spent
true